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Karterados' airport?
If you’re travelling by plane, you won’t have to think too long and hard about which airport to choose. Karterados has just one – Santorini National Airport (JTR).
How far is Santorini National Airport (JTR) from central Karterados?
Santorini National Airport (JTR) is just a short drive from all the action of downtown Karterados. It’s located 2 kilometres from the city centre.
What airport is best to fly into Karterados?
Santorini Airport is the only major airport in Karterados. Before you fly, it’s a smart idea to know a little about it. It is located 2 kilometres from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Karterados?
Karterados is serviced by 11 airlines from at least 17 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Karterados?
Aegean Airlines and Sky Express are some of the most well-known airlines that offer flights to Karterados. Travellers often pick Athens as a starting point with Aegean Airlines operating the most flights on this route.
How many nonstop flights are there to Karterados?
With around 83 direct flights running every week, you’ll be arriving in Karterados before you have time to say, “Are we there yet?”
Where are the most popular flights to Karterados departing from?
Flights to Karterados departing from Athens, London and Greater Manchester airports are the most in demand.
How long is the flight to Karterados Airport?
If it’s Athens you’re leaving behind, you’ll be airborne for around 49 minutes before you arrive in Karterados. Runway to runway from London generally takes 3 hours and 53 minutes and from Orly, it’s 3 hours and 25 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Karterados?
Depending on where you’re coming from, your trip to Karterados could be a piece of cake or it could go on forever. Below are some useful tips that will help you start your unforgettable escape on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having a stress-free flight experience is to pack ahead. So, let’s start with the basics: passport, travel documents, credit cards and daily medications. Next, take on board items that’ll help keep you occupied, like some electronic devices or a magazine. It’s also a wise idea to pack your chargers, a quality ne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. Finally, don’t forget to squeeze in toiletry items like a toothbrush, facial wipes and a spare set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don’t have a pocket knife lurking in the bottom of your carry-on luggage. Other prohibited items include flammable or explosive goods, such as aerosol cans and fuel, and liquids and gels in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should always be your main priority when selecting what to wear on your flight. Consider your footwear choice with care too, as swollen ankles and feet can be a side effect of flying. Flat shoes which are slightly roomy are always a good idea.
  • A serious condition known as D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-distance flights. It results from blood clots forming due to poor circulation. Walking up and down the aisle and doing leg and foot exercises in your seat helps to prevent this from happening. Wearing a pair of compression socks also helps reduce the ris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Karterados?
Being prepared before you get to the airport can make your trip to Karterados easy and painless. We’ve rounded up some handy hints for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Have your passport and travel documents within close reach. They’re the first items you’ll be asked to present to airport security.
  • Your belt, jacket, keys and other small items, like your earphones, will need to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as your turn draws near.
  • All your electronic devices, including your phone and tablet, must also be scanned.
  • Remove liquids and gels from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each product should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you a few prec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on sneakers are usually not.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, pack them safely away in your checked suitcase. They won’t be allowed on board.
